About Trib Nation

Welcome to the Trib Nation newsroom blog, your home base for the inside story of journalism at the Chicago Tribune. Trib Nation is the umbrella for how we stay connected with you -- in print, online and in person -- to improve our journalism.
We invite your participation in discussions about news-gathering and live Tribune events. For our part, we share who we are, how we go about our journalism at the Chicago Tribune and why we do the things we do. At the same time, we're listening to you and this is a place to showcase what readers are saying about coverage.
Our reporting achieves a fuller, richer truth by including you. Feedback and comments inform what we do. Your tips help us develop more meaningful stories.
